The Church of St Philip and St James is a church in Tow Law, County Durham, England. The church was designed by architect Charles Hodgson Fowler (1840-1910) and completed in 1869. Built of sandstone, the decorated church features a south-west tower.

It became a Grade II listed building on 5 June 1987. The church is administered as one of The Four Parishes - including St Mary & St Stephen Wolsingham, St Bartholomew Thornley Village and St.Cuthbert Satley.
